How they compare
Kyrgyzstan currently reports 2.85 Mt CO2e against 2.67 Mt CO2e in Madagascar, a difference of 0.1832 Mt CO2e.
That makes Kyrgyzstan's figure about 1.1 times Madagascar's.
Across all 55 years both countries report, Kyrgyzstan has been ahead every year.
Globally, Kyrgyzstan ranks 84th and Madagascar ranks 87th of 203 countries.

About this data
A measure of annual emissions of methane (CH4), one of the six Kyoto greenhouse gases (GHG), from the waste sector. This includes emissions from solid waste (IPCC 2006 codes 4.A Solid Waste Disposal, 4.B Biological Treatment of Solid Waste, 4.C Incineration and Open Burning of Waste) and wastewater treatment (IPCC 2006 code 4.D Wastewater Treatment and Discharge). The measure is standardized to carbon dioxide equivalent values using the Global Warming Potential (GWP) factors of IPCC's 5th Assessment Report (AR5).
